WHAT IS AGARWOOD?

Agarwood, known as lapnisan in the Philippines and gaharu in other Southeast Asian country, forms a dark, resinous core in its heartwood when inoculated. This resinous heartwood is highly prized for its rich and distinctive fragrance.
Aquilaria malaccensis is a tree native to the Philippines. The tree has become endagered due to overharvesting and illegal trade, leading the Philippine goverment to prohibit the harvesting of Aquilaria malaccensis from the wild.

USES OF AGARWOOd

Agarwood has held significant cultural and spiritual importance since ancient times, with references in both the Old and New Testaments. Today, it remains in high demand for daily use, ceremonies, spiritual practices, and as luxury item. Its largest markets include the Middle East, China, Europe and the USA.

Market Size & Growth

Chips

The global agarwood chip market grew at 7.7% CAGR 2018-2022, with a valuation of US$44.05 billion in 2023.
Estimated to continue to increase at 7.1% CAGR to reach a market size of US$87.46 billion USD by the end of 2033.

Oil

The global agarwood essential oil market valued at US$135.1million in 2023. Projected to reach a market size of US$295.1 million by the end of 2033.
